SK Hynix has experienced a limit down in pre-market trading on NXT, as South Korea introduces static volatility interruption to address abnormal fluctuations.
According to reports, the South Korean alternative trading platform NEXTRADE experienced unusual fluctuations during pre-market trading again. SK Hynix hit the lower limit price after only trading 11 shares. In pre-market trading at 8 a.m. that day, only 11 shares were traded at 1,168,000 won per share, down 29.97% from the previous day's closing price. After trading resumed, the decline quickly narrowed to around 3% to 4%. NXT plans to introduce a static volatility interruption mechanism starting next month to prevent orders that deviate significantly from the previous day's closing price from being executed immediately.
